PR24851, gas/testsuite/gas/epiphany/badrelax.s failure with MALLOC_PERTURB_=1

PR 24851
	* config/tc-epiphany.c (md_estimate_size_before_relax): Clear
	extra opcode bytes when changing from a 2-byte to a 4-byte insn.
